- Is an Osprey a carnivore - Answers
The osprey is a bird of prey, similar to, but smaller than an eagle They are primarily fish eaters, and there is only one species worldwide, pandion haliaetus
- What are the ospreys babies called? - Answers
There is no specific name for a Osprey baby other then the generic term Chick(s), the chicks that have finally fledged are simply called Juveniles

- How does the size of an osprey compare to other birds of prey?
The osprey is a medium-sized bird of prey, larger than some smaller raptors like falcons and hawks, but smaller than larger ones like eagles and vultures
